Does this course meet the CA BBS requirement?

If a registrant fails to obtain a passing score on the California Law and Ethics examination prior to the registration’s expiration date, you must attach proof of completing a 12-hour course in California Law and Ethics to regain eligibility to take the California Law and Ethics examination during your next renewal cycle.

When can I take the law and Ethics exam?

Once you register as an Associate MFT, CSW, or PCC with the Board of Behavioral Sciences, you have a year to attempt the California Law and Ethics Exam for your profession.Aug 29, 2018

Is BBS Ce4Less approved?

Ce4Less is a CA BBS provider. As of January 1, 2015, the CA BBS will no longer issue continuing education providers CA BBS provider numbers. Instead, the board will accept continuing education courses from a provider who has been approved or registered by a board recognized approval agency.

What is the passing score for the law and Ethics exam?

around 35 out of 50California PCC Law & Ethics Exam Passing scores have typically been around 35 out of 50 scored items (70%). It would be unusual to have a passing score below 33 or above 37.

How do I take the law and Ethics exam?

Applications can be found on www.bbs.ca.gov. Once the application requirements are met, Pearson VUE will send an authorization to test notice which includes an ID number that candidates will need to register to take the examination (see page 3).

How hard is the law and Ethics exam?

You have 90 minutes to finish the test. The exam plan reviews the scope of knowledge that is tested. In the first quarter of 2017, approximately 71% of examinees passed and 29% failed. Passing rates in previous cycles ranged from 67% to 84%.Jul 17, 2017

How many times can you take the law and Ethics exam?

It is possible that registrants to have three (3) attempts to pass the examination during each renewal cycle, so long as a re-examination application and fee are received timely for each attempt.

How to file a complaint against a course?

You should first contact the provider of the course to resolve your concerns. If you are not satisfied with the outcome, contact the provider’s approval agency and/or send your complaint in writing to the Board. Include the course name, date, location, the names of the instructor and provider, and specifics about your complaint.

How many hours of CE do I need to renew my license?

Law and Ethics:ALL licensees are required to complete at least six (6) hours of CE in Law and Ethics as a condition of each and every renewal. These hours count toward the total 36 (or 18) hour requirement.

Can you count CE hours on a BBS license?

subject matter relates to both scopes of practice. CE earned for other licenses may be applied to your BBS-issued license if the provider is acceptable and the subject matter relates to your license’s scope of practice. If you are a supervisor of a Board registrant, you may count your supervisor training hours if the training was taken from an acceptable CE provider.

How long do you have to keep your CE certificate?

You must maintain documentation ofcompleted CE courses (certificates, transcripts, etc.) for at least two (2) years after the license renewal period during which youtook the courses. DO NOT submit your course certificates with your renewal. The Board will not retain them.

Can the Board of Education audit your records?

The Board may audit your records to verify completion of CE. If you are selected for audit, you will be notified in writing andrequired to submit documentation of courses (or alternative CE methods) completed. If audited, a prompt response is important.

Can you claim CE credit for teaching a course?

You may claim CE credit for teaching a course if the course meets all other CE requirements. You can claim the same amount of hours as an attendee. You may claim credit for teaching a course once during a single renewal period.
